I have just bought a new pc and downloaded GW2. I soon noticed that objects appeared purple as well as some textures. I also noticed that attack animations such as explosions were purple and pixelated as well as fire. I then realised that many objects and bridges weren’t appearing and would just be invisible.
My OS is windows 7 pro and I’ve got an NVidia gtx 660 which as I’ve seen from other threads is having problems and quite frankly I don’t know what to do. Looks a bit similar to the problem Guild wars has with Windows 10 and mobile Nvidia gpus.

Try:
a) running in Windows 7 compatibility mode …OR
b) Running the game without Vsync enabled, and
c) use borderless windowed mode to avoid screentearing.

You may want to try earlier drivers if you have updated to the latest ones. Nvidia are known for gimping old gpus in various ways with later driver releases for obvious reasons.
